tranny question
Anybody know which turbo 350 tail housing to use when replacing a 3speed stick with the auto so as not to have to rework the drive shaft? Truck is a short step with a 292 inline.Thanks

Re: tranny question
I'd be surprised if you get away without redoing the drive shaft regardless. I replaced my three speed with a 700R4, and I dont think even a 350 is of near similar size to the original manual 3-speed.
I am running a 250 inline. I think I have around $ 150.00 in the driveshaft and 50 or 60 bucks in the new slip yoke. |

Re: tranny question
I replaced my manual with a short tail TH350. Bolted right up with no mods to the driveshaft. '72 LWB C-10.
